Lake Rabon is an artificial lake in Laurens County in the U.S. state of South Carolina, formed by an earth gravity dam on the south side of the lake at the confluence of Payne's Branch and Rabon Creek. It is owned by the Laurens County Water and Sewer Commission (LCWSC). A number of residences abut the lake. LCWSC sells permits for fishing and for no-power or low-power boating.
